Never fear, Trisha Ramos is Living Waters’ girl! She’s got a website and a blog, Fish with Trish, and there she’s got articles and videos to help women and teach them how to share their faith. She’s an amazing lady.

Trisha does have a page on her website detailing how you can book her for an event. She’s a pastor’s wife in Texas and is quite busy with Living Waters, but you can send a request for her to come and speak at a women’s event or a women’s Bible study.

Women of Faith also is coming to Rochester, New York a few times: November 4-5, 2011 and September 14, 2012. The events are a bit pricey, though. The events are $99 per person, though; if you come in a group of 10 or more, it’s $89 per person.
